Translation services - Post-editing of machine translation output - Requirements

ISO 18587:2017 provides requirements for the process of full, human post-editing of machine translation output and post-editors' competences.
ISO 18587:2017 is intended to be used by TSPs, their clients, and post-editors.
It is only applicable to content processed by MT systems.
NOTE For translation services in general, see ISO 17100.

Introduction
The use of machine translation (MT) systems to meet the needs of an increasingly demanding
translation and localization industry has been gaining ground. Many translation service providers
(TSPs) and clients have come to realize that the use of such systems is a viable solution for translating
projects that need to be completed within a very tight time frame and/or with a reduced budget.
When an MT system is used, clients can have material translated that can otherwise not be translated;
translation costs can be decreased and the launch of products on specific markets, as well as the flow of
information, can be accelerated. On the other hand, TSPs are able to:
a) improve translation productivity;
b) improve turn-around times;
c) remain competitive in an environment where clients show an increasing demand for using MT in
translation.
However, there is no MT system with an output which can be qualified as equal to the output of human
translation and, therefore, the final quality of the translation output still depends on human translators
and, for this purpose, their competence in post-editing.
The rate at which MT systems are changing renders it impractical to produce an overarching
International Standard on these systems, which could stifle innovation or be ignored by the translation
technology development industry.
This document therefore restricts its provisions to that part of the process that begins upon the delivery
of the MT output and the beginning of the human process that is known as post-editing.

3.1 Concepts related to machine translation
3.1.1
machine translation
MT
automatic translation (3.4.2) of text (3.2.6) from one natural language to another using a computer
application
[SOURCE: ISO 17100:2015, 2.2.2, modified – reference to translation of speech has been deleted as it
is not relevant to this document; also “automated has been replaced by “automatic” in order to avoid
confusion with translation memory tools]
3.1.2
machine translation output
MT output
result of machine translation (3.1.1)
[SOURCE: ISO 17100:2015, 2.2.3, modified – “outcome” has been changed to “result”]
3.1.3
machine translation system
technology used to perform machine translation (3.1.1)
3.1.4
post-edit
edit and correct machine translation output (3.1.2)
[SOURCE: ISO 17100:2015, 2.2.4, modified – the note has been deleted]
3.1.5
full post-editing
process of post-editing (3.1.4) to obtain a product comparable to a product obtained by human
translation (3.4.3)
3.1.6
light post-editing
process of post-editing (3.1.4) to obtain a merely comprehensible text without any attempt to produce a
product comparable to a product obtained by human translation (3.4.3)
3.2 Concepts related to language and content
3.2.1
content
information in any form
EXAMPLE Text, audio, video, etc.
3.2.2
source language
language of the content (3.2.1) to be translated (3.4.1)
3.2.3
source language content
language content (3.2.1) to be translated (3.4.1)
[SOURCE: ISO 17100:2015, 2.2.3]
3.2.4
target language
language into which source language content (3.2.3) is translated (3.4.1)
[SOURCE: ISO 17100:2015, 2.3.6]
3.2.5
target language content
language content (3.2.1) translated (3.4.1) from source language content (3.2.3)
[SOURCE: ISO 17100:2015, 2.3.3]
3.2.6
text
content (3.2.1) in written form
[SOURCE: ISO 17100:2015, 2.3.4]
3.2.7
natural language
NL
language with its origin unknown, but continuously developing sometimes in idiosyncratic ways as is
used conventionally for human communication
[SOURCE: ISO/TS 24620, 2.12]

3.2.8
controlled natural language
controlled language
CNL
subset of natural languages (3.2.7) whose grammars and dictionaries have been restricted in order to
reduce or eliminate both ambiguity and complexity
Note 1 to entry: As a generic, CNL is an uncountable noun that refers to the abstract properties of all controlled
natural languages and not to a particular natural language or application for a specific purpose. It is engineered
(i.e. constructed) with a view to reducing or eliminating ambiguity and complexity and aims both to make it
easier for human readers (particularly non-native users, non-experts and people with limited comprehension) to
read a text (3.2.6), and to improve the computational processing of a text.
Note 2 to entry: CNL is an engineered (i.e. constructed) language that is based on a particular natural language,
but is more restrictive as regards lexicon, syntax, or semantics, while at the same time preserving most of its
natural properties. Here, CNL is a countable noun.
[SOURCE: ISO/TS 24620, 2.6]
